I-52 disappeared in the mid-Atlantic on June 23–24, 1944—along with 112 souls and a cargo list that reads like wartime desperation: tungsten, rubber, opium, quinine, and 146 gold bars meant to pay for German technology. This documentary follows the true story of how I-52 was hunted, struck, and later found nearly 17,000 feet down in a lightless, crushing abyss.
Using sonobuoys and the secret Mark 24 “Fido” acoustic homing torpedo, a USS Bogue Avenger tracked I-52 by sound—propellers, then the torpedo’s whine, then the detonation and the groan of steel. Decades later, the search became survival engineering: correcting wartime coordinates, beating the Deep Scattering Layer, and towing side-scan sonar to spot the unmistakable 356-foot shadow of a Type C3 cargo submarine.
When the Mir submersibles finally reached the seabed, I-52 sat upright—scarred with damage consistent with the kill. The team applied debris-field geometry and hydrodynamic sorting to hunt for the bullion… and recovered a container believed to be cargo—only to find it held opium, not gold. The I-52 treasure likely remains buried in soft sediment or pinned beneath heavy wreckage, turning recovery into an extreme deep-sea salvage problem—and a war-grave ethical line.
